LeRotary Notes The Rotary Club of LeRoy gathered virtually on April 28, 2021, with 18 members present and no guests. President Mary Margaret welcomed everyone. Dasha Halladay led the group in the Pledge of Allegiance followed by a prayer by Bob Carlsen. President Mary Margaret shared announcements. President Mary Margaret announced that beginning next week, the meetings will move to outdoors at the American Legion Pavilion. There will be a boxed lunch option from the D&R Depot. Martha Bailey asked about the options of being able to move the meetings back to an inside location. President Mary Margaret said she continues to work on it. President Mary Margaret thanked the few Rotarians who participated in the guided hike at Genesee County Park. Shannon Karcher also reminded the club of the upcoming Shred-it event on May 8, 2021, in the parking lot of OrCon. The event will be from 8:00-Noon. Shannon is still in need of volunteers to help with the event. It will be a drive-thru event where people will be able to have their documents safely shredded. People will be able to pay $10.00 per banker-sized box or medium kitchen bag. The event is secure and all documents will be shredding onsite by Shred-it. On May 15th, the club will help clean up some of the banks of Oatka Creek. More information to follow. President Mary Margaret also requested ideas for the installation dinner when President-Elect Ben Deragon will become the next President of the club. President Mary Margaret moved on to missed meetings. Missed meetings were sanctioned to Gerry Aron (1), Bob Bennett (1), Scott McCumiskey (1), Jake Whiting (2), and Carol Wolfe. Gerry Aron was the only member who didn’t have make-up and will be fined accordingly. President Mary Margaret moved on to the fining session. Gerry Aron was fined for his 15 years as being a driver for S&S Limousine. When asked if he had stories he could share, he said way too many. He shared the experience was fun and he was able to meet a lot of great people. David Grayson was fined for a photo on social media of his daughter who had accidentally missed her mouth and a metal straw poked her in the eye. She is fine! Jake Whiting was fined for his wife posting adorable family photos on his birthday. Betsy Halvorson was fined for her excitement around the new roof going on the public library. She said it is very welcomed! There was no formal program today. President Mary Margaret thanked everyone and adjourned at 12:36 pm.
